6. Your Rights as a Data Subject
Under the Kenyan Data Protection Act, 2019, you have the following rights regarding your personal data:
- The Right to Access: You can request a copy of the personal data we hold about you.
- The Right to Rectification: You can request the correction of inaccurate or incomplete data.
- The Right to Erasure: You can request the deletion of your personal data, subject to our legal and regulatory retention requirements.
- The Right to Restrict Processing: You can request that we limit the way we use your data.
- The Right to Object: You can object to the processing of your data for certain purposes, such as direct marketing.
- The Right to Data Portability: You can request your data in a structured, commonly used, and machine-readable format.
To exercise any of these rights, please contact our support team. You also have the right to lodge a complaint with the Office of the Data Protection Commissioner (ODPC) in Kenya if you believe we have infringed upon your rights.
